CCMM Norms & Nobility Chapter 8 Part 1

In Chapter 8, David Hicks looks at "The Promise of Christian Paideia." In this chapter, his discussion of classical education shifts from the ancient Greeks to the era of Christian education. In this episode, our panelists consider sections 1 and 2 in which Hicks outlines the problems of classical pagan education and looks at how Christ provides the answer to those problems.

CCMM Norms & Nobility Chapter 5 Part 3

Join your Norms & Nobility friends as they discuss part 3 of chapter 5! The crew explores the idea that mathematics bridges the gap between ancients' focus on the ideal types and the moderns' focus on the utility of harnessing nature for man's own ends.
